What to evaluate in

A direct comparison starts with the closure mechanism and the bag’s overall construction. Look for an even zipper track that closes smoothly without gaps, since weak closure points can compromise product security. Material choice matters too: thicker films generally resist punctures and reduce the chance of tears during packing. Consider also clarity and labeling space, because visibility can speed Insulated Food Bags Australia up picking and reduce packing errors. For food-related packing, cleanliness and consistent seal behavior are key, particularly when bags move between preparation areas and delivery workflows. Finally, assess convenience features: easy opening, stable flat lay, and a shape that supports quick portioning and stacking in warehouses or retail back rooms.
